Tomany Mountain
Peak
Tomany Mountain is a 2,589-foot-tall mountain in the Adirondack Mountains region of New York. It is located northwest of Arietta in Hamilton County. In 1912, the Conservation Commission built a wooden fire observation tower on the mountain. Tomany Mountain is situated 2 miles northwest of State Brook.

Arietta
Hamlet
Arietta is a town in Hamilton County, New York, United States. The population was 292 at the 2020 census. The town was named after the mother of one of the first settlers, Rensselaer Van Rennslaer. Arietta is situated 1½ miles southeast of State Brook.
